Scott Stapp’s estranged wife is trying to get the troubled Creed singer committed against his will to a mental health facility. Jaclyn Stapp and her mother filed legal papers on Wednesday trying to convince a judge to force Scott Stapp into psychiatric treatment. They believe Stapp is delusional and psychotic, and that he poses a danger to himself because he’s allegedly attempting to detox without assistance.

As Gossip Cop reported, Stapp shocked the world this week when he released a video in which the onetime wealthy rocker admitted to being homeless and nearly broke after years of alleged theft by the people he trusted. Stapp insisted that he is sober, and blamed his problems on the IRS having a vendetta against him following Stapp’s public criticism of President Obama.

But Stapp’s issues may be far worse. Earlier this month, the performer was placed on a three-day psychiatric hold for his erratic and paranoid behavior. His wife and mother-in-law believe he’s still into heavy drug use, including amphetamines, PCP and cocaine. According to TMZ, they believe he’s specifically delusional about a potential ISIS attack on his son’s school, with Stapp also allegedly seized by fears about biological weapons and being poisoned. They think he poses a significant threat to himself and others if he doesn’t get prolonged and rigorous mental health treatment. Gossip Cop will have updates if Stapp is indeed hospitalized.
